Dysport®

Dysport is a simple, effective, non-surgical treatment that works by relaxing facial muscles on the forehead, thereby reducing and smoothing away frown-lines and wrinkles.

Dysport is supported by over a decade of clinical experience. Dysport was developed in the United Kingdom in the early 1990s to successfully treat a number of neurological and ophthalmic conditions. Since that time, with an increased understanding of the uses of Dysport, thousands of treatments have been safely and effectively performed for a variety of conditions ranging from frown lines to axillary hyperhidrosis (excessive sweating under the armpits).

Frown lines 101: What causes them?

Over time, repeated movement of the facial skin by the muscles forms frown lines between the eyebrows. Wrinkles are not only age related. Frown lines are “dynamic”—they happen because of the way a person’s face moves. Because frown lines are created by facial movements such as frowning or squinting, they may develop even in younger adults. Dysport is used to treat moderate to severe frown lines in adult patients less than 65 years of age.

The muscles above and between the eyebrows contract and tighten, and can cause wrinkles. Dysport blocks the nerve signal that causes these facial muscles to contract. This ultimately results in a localized reduction of muscle activity in the treated area and temporarily stops the contraction of these muscles.

In New Zealand, Dysport has been used for many years, by eye specialists and neurologists, to treat nervous tics and muscle spasms of the face and neck. In fact, Dysport has been available in New Zealand for over 12 years for treating neuro-muscular conditions and was the first botulinum toxin Type A to be approved in New Zealand for medical use.

Dysport is manufactured in Britain by Ipsen Limited.
